Comparison review

Samsung Galaxy Note8 has an overall score of 83, which is a bit better than Asus ZenFone 6 (2019)'s 77.8 global score. These devices work with Android operating system, but the Samsung Galaxy Note8 has 9.0 Pie version and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) has Android 11 version. The Samsung Galaxy Note8 is an older and a bit heavier phone than the Asus ZenFone 6 (2019), but Samsung managed to build it a bit thinner anyway.

Samsung Galaxy Note8 counts with just a bit better screen than Asus ZenFone 6 (2019), because although it has a quite smaller display, it also counts with more pixels per inch of screen and a higher resolution of 1440 x 2960px.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) features a lot bigger memory capacity for games and applications than Galaxy Note8, and although they both have equal 64 GB internal storage capacity, the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) also has a slot for an SD memory card that supports a maximum of 1,95 TB.

The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) counts with just a bit better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y Note8. They have the same RAM memory amount and a Octa-Core CPU.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) features a way better battery lifetime than Galaxy Note8, because it has a 52 percent greater battery size.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) has a much better camera than Galaxy Note8, because although it has a tinier aperture which is worse for taking pictures in low-light environments, and they both have the same 3840x2160 (4K) video quality, the Asus ZenFone 6 (2019) also counts with faster video frame rate, a much more megapixels back camera and a much bigger sensor providing a way higher image quality.

Even being the best phone of the ones we are comparing, Galaxy Note8 is also cheaper than the other phone, which makes this phone an easy choice.
